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2 (11 oz.) cans corn, drained
1 (8 oz.) pkg. cream cheese, softened
1/3 cup evaporated milk ( half & half)
1 pickled jalapeņo pepper, sliced

Directions:
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Spray a 9" x 9" casserole dish with cooking spray.

In a mixing bowl, combine cream cheese and milk until smooth. Stir in corn and jalapeņo peppers. Transfer mixture to the prepared dish and cover with a lid or foil.

Bake in a preheated 350 degrees F. oven for 40 to 50 minutes.
